Hugo Santiago Muchnick was born in Buenos Aires, Argentina and lived in France from 1959 until his death in 2018. He studied Literature, Philosophy and Music. From 1959-66 he was assistant director to Robert Bresson. In 1969, he made his first feature film Invasión in his native Argentina based on an idea by celebrated writers Adolfo Bioy Casares and Jorge Luis Borges, who also co-wrote the script.
